An Introduction to the Study of the Kabalah first came to light in 1910 by William Wynn Westcott (17 December 1848 - 30 July 1925) he was a Freemason, Theosophist, Ceremonial Magician, Coroner, Doctor of Medicine.and also the Supreme Magus (chief) of the S. R. I. A (Societas Rosicruciana in Anglia) also was one of the founders of the Hermetic Order of the Golden Dawn. In his own words: "Students of literature, philosophy and religion who have any sympathy with the Occult Sciences may well pay some attention to the Kabalah of the Hebrew Rabbis of olden times; for whatever faith may be held by the enquirer he will gain not only knowledge, but also will broaden his views of life and destiny, by comparing other forms of religion with the faith and doctrines in which he has been nurtured, or which he has adopted after reaching full age and powers of discretion."
